Bootstrap datetimepicker устанавливает секунды в 0 - PullRequest
0 голосов
/ 13 октября 2019

Проблема: я получаю вывод, например, «2019-10-14T08: 12: 48», и я хочу, чтобы секунды были равны 00, т. Е. «2019-10-14T08: 12: 00»

Я не могуизвлеките ss из формата, так как я отправляю на контроллер, который принимает только LocalDataTime и требует включения секунд.

В настоящее время я использую приведенный ниже код и зависимость для добавления функциональности выбора даты и времени ввходные данные поданы.

<dependency>
    <groupId>org.webjars</groupId>
    <artifactId>bootstrap-datetimepicker</artifactId>
    <version>2.4.2</version>
</dependency>

Javascript код

window.addEventListener("load", function() {
  //set up datetime picker so it loads on first click
  $('#time-input').datetimepicker({
    language: 'en',
    showMeridian: true,
    startDate: '+1h',
    minuteStep: 1,
  });

  //on click for input to toggle the datetimepicker
  $('#time-input').click(function(event) {
    $('#time-input').datetimepicker();
  });
}

HTML:

<input id="time-input" type="text" class="form-control" 
   data-date-format="yyyy-mm-ddTHH:ii:ss">
...